SCS Software will be giving truckers the opportunity to be involved in Texas’ booming space industry in its upcoming Texas DLC for American Truck Simulator. Truckers can look forward to exploring launch sites from previous space missions and will have the chance to make deliveries for the Starbay facility.
SCS Software has provided several new in-progress space industry screenshots in a recent blog post on the upcoming content. The developer has also recently released a gameplay video showcasing how the massive Texas map expansion is coming along so far. You can watch the Texas DLC gameplay video below.
“Texas is home to state-of-the-art development and test sites for multiple commercial space firms, and research shows that the space industry is big work for the state, bringing in 11 billion dollars per year in revenue and providing hundreds of thousands of jobs,” explains the blog post. “So it wouldn’t be right for us to miss this out-of-this-world opportunity to include it in our upcoming Texas DLC for American Truck Simulator.”
As part of the space industry content, truckers will be able to deliver important goods and construction materials for Texas’ Starbay facility, which features a spaceport and production areas. Truckers will also be able to explore Houston’s famous space center, where previously used rockets and shuttles will be on display.
